Re: Start Camcorder directly
The command line to directly launch the camera in video mode is "\Windows\Camera.exe" -v
In Titanium use "\Windows\Camera.exe;-v" and in the registry "\\Windows\\Camera.exe;-v" |

Here's a quick shortcut I created, just rename it to .lnk instead of .txt and put it in your \Windows\Start Menu\Programs folder :)
Edit: Just found that after using this shortcut, the regular camera shortcut defaults to video (as many stated, its just defaulting to previous mode). So, I created another shortcut to launch in photo mode (using the -i switch). I've attached a Zip file w/ both shortcuts. They are already .lnk files, so just extract them to the same folder as above. |
